A QUICK INTRODUCTION

Welcome to Djuztin, a Dutch-based company founded in 2016 by Justin Knelange that mostly specializes in Automotive and Event Photography. Justin’s passion for cars and photography started at a young age and he has been dedicated to his hobby of car photography for over six years now. Throughout these years, he is always striving to improve his photography skills through learning from colleagues, expanding his equipment and pursuing Photographic Designer course at MediaCollege Amsterdam from 2020 until 2024.

HISTORIC ZANDVOORT TROPHY

On Sunday, the 7th of May 2023, I visited a car event at Zandvoort Circuit, Netherlands. Last year I also went to an event in May organized by Nationaal Oldtimer Festival and I really enjoyed it, which is why this year I decided to go again.

Me and a couple friends went out there in the early morning and throughout the day, we’ve seen really cool cars and builds. A Chevy-swapped Opel which the owner worked 2,5 years on, a Opel Lotus Omega (a dream car of mine), Toyota Supra and Chaser, Porsche 944’s and other original and tuned cars.

Except for the rain near the end, it was a great day. Lots of happy people and such a good vibe. Many people also came for a talk or took photos. And it was filled with so many cool cars. I’ll definitely visit again!


FORGOTTEN CITROËNS

I had the pleasure of doing a photoshoot of abandoned Citroëns in a barn recently, and it was a great experience. The owner was kind enough to show us around and let us take pictures of the amazing collection, which consisted of around 60 Citroëns, including some rarer models.

The lighting in the barn was absolutely perfect, giving the cars a moody and dramatic look that was nice for photography. It was such a thrill to walk around and explore the space, admiring the unique features and details of each car.

But what really stood out to me was the story behind the collection. The person who showed us around was working on restoring the Citroëns one by one with his dad, and they had managed to save most of them from the scrapyard. It was heartening to see such dedication and passion for preserving these vintage cars.

COFFEE RUN IN ZAANDAM

On the 29th of April, 2023, car enthusiasts in Zaandam, the Netherlands, were treated to an exciting event organized by Collecting Cars – the Coffee Run. This gathering, which was the second edition of its kind in the country, brought together a diverse community of automotive enthusiasts.

This second edition of the event took place from 9:00 AM to 12:00 PM near Hembrugterrein. Visitors were treated to a great varietyof impressive cars, ranging from sleek modern models to meticulously maintained classics. For example, think of Porsche 944’s, a Jaguar D-Type replica, Renault Clio RS V6, Lucid Air and much more.

The Coffee Run in Zaandam was blessed with great weather, making it an even more enjoyable experience. The sun was shining brightly, and mostly clear skies provided the perfect backdrop for the event. I had a great time!
